What Is Salesforce Service Cloud Voice?

Salesforce Service Cloud Voice (SCV) is Salesforce's native telephony framework that brings voice calls directly into the Service Cloud console. Rather than treating phone calls as a separate channel, SCV embeds voice into the same omnichannel workspace where agents handle chats, emails, cases, and social interactions.

How Service Cloud Voice Works

SCV operates on a telephony partner model. Instead of building its own phone system, Salesforce partners with cloud telephony providers — like Aircall — who plug into the SCV framework. This gives organizations the flexibility to choose their preferred telephony provider while maintaining a unified agent experience inside Salesforce.

Key SCV capabilities include:

  • Omni-Channel routing — Distributes calls alongside chats and cases based on agent availability, skill, and capacity
  • VoiceCall records — Automatically creates Salesforce records for every call, linking them to contacts, cases, and accounts
  • Embedded phone controls — Agents make and receive calls using an in-console widget, not a separate application
  • Real-time transcription — Converts speech to text during live calls (powered by the telephony partner's AI)
  • Supervisor monitoring — Managers can listen in, whisper coaching, or barge into live calls

The Telephony Partner Model

Organizations using SCV choose between two paths:

  1. Amazon Connect (Salesforce's default partner) — Salesforce's built-in option using AWS infrastructure
  2. Partner telephony providers — Third-party providers like Aircall, Five9, and Genesys that integrate via the SCV framework

Aircall's native SCV integration represents the partner telephony path — bringing Aircall's cloud phone system, AI features, and 200+ integrations directly into the Salesforce console.

How Does Aircall's Native Integration Work?

Aircall's native Salesforce Service Cloud Voice integration, announced on August 26, 2025, goes far beyond the traditional CTI adapter approach. It embeds Aircall's full telephony and AI capabilities directly into the Salesforce console.

"Aircall's native integration with Salesforce helps customers get up and running faster on their voice channel. With full customer context and AI-powered insights, service reps deliver support that's not just faster, but truly personalized." — Kishan Chetan, EVP & GM of Service Cloud, Salesforce

Core Architecture

When Aircall is connected as your SCV telephony partner:

  • Calls route through Aircall's cloud infrastructure and surface inside the Salesforce Omni-Channel widget
  • Agent controls (answer, hold, mute, transfer, end) operate natively within the Service Cloud console
  • All call data — recordings, transcriptions, AI insights, and metadata — automatically writes to Salesforce VoiceCall records
  • Smartflows (Aircall's routing engine) handles intelligent call distribution based on business hours, holidays, agent skills, and custom rules

What Changed vs. the Older CTI Adapter Approach

Before the native SCV integration, organizations used Aircall's CTI (Computer Telephony Integration) adapter built on Salesforce's Open CTI framework. Here's how the two approaches compare:

Feature Legacy CTI Adapter Native SCV Integration (2025+)
Architecture JavaScript-based pop-ups overlaying Salesforce Fully embedded in the SCV console
Call Controls Separate Aircall widget Native Omni-Channel phone widget
Data Sync API-based logging (sometimes delayed) Real-time auto-sync to VoiceCall records
AI Features Limited — required separate Aircall dashboard Transcription, sentiment, and summaries embedded in Salesforce
Routing Basic Aircall routing, separate from Salesforce Smartflows + Salesforce Omni-Channel unified routing
Setup Complexity Moderate — custom configuration needed Streamlined — faster time to value
Supervisor Tools Aircall dashboard only Native Salesforce supervisor monitoring + Aircall insights

The bottom line: The native integration eliminates the "two systems" problem. Agents and supervisors work entirely within Salesforce while leveraging Aircall's telephony and AI engine under the hood.

Core Features: What You Get With Aircall for Service Cloud Voice

1. Auto-Call Logging

Every inbound and outbound call automatically creates a VoiceCall record in Salesforce. These records capture:

  • Call duration, timestamp, and direction (inbound/outbound)
  • Caller and agent information
  • Call recording link
  • AI-generated insights (summaries, topics, sentiment)
  • Associated contact, account, and case records

No manual logging. No missed data. Every conversation becomes a structured, searchable CRM record.

2. Complete Customer Context From the First Ring

When a call comes in, agents instantly see the customer's full history:

  • Previous support tickets and resolution status
  • Recent chat and email conversations
  • Product purchase history and account details
  • Prior call recordings and notes
  • Customer preferences and communication history

This screen-pop functionality means agents can greet customers by name and reference their most recent interaction — eliminating the dreaded "Can you explain your issue again?" friction.

3. AI-Powered Real-Time Transcription

Aircall's transcription engine converts speech to text in real time during live calls. Transcripts are:

  • Searchable — Find specific conversations across your entire call history
  • Linked to CRM records — Automatically attached to the VoiceCall and associated case
  • Available for review — Managers can read transcripts for coaching without listening to full recordings

Agents focus on the conversation instead of taking notes. Post-call wrap-up drops from minutes to seconds.

4. Sentiment Analysis

Aircall's AI monitors the emotional tone of conversations in real time:

  • Live emotion tracking — Agents see whether customer sentiment is positive, neutral, or negative during the call
  • Frustration detection — Alerts when sentiment shifts downward, prompting agents to adjust their approach
  • Supervisor dashboards — Managers monitor sentiment across multiple concurrent calls and intervene when needed
  • Post-call logging — Sentiment data writes to the VoiceCall record for trend analysis and coaching

5. AI-Generated Call Summaries and Key Topics

After every call, Aircall's AI automatically generates:

  • Concise call summaries — Key points, outcomes, and follow-up actions
  • Key topics — Automatically identified subjects discussed during the call
  • Action items — Recommended next steps for the agent or team

These summaries ensure that the next agent who interacts with the customer has instant context — even if they weren't on the original call.

6. Intelligent Routing With Smartflows

Aircall's Smartflows engine lets administrators build sophisticated call routing rules:

  • Business hours and holiday schedules — Route calls differently based on time of day and calendar
  • Team and skill-based routing — Direct calls to agents with the right expertise
  • Queue management — Set priority rules, overflow handling, and callback options
  • IVR menus — Build interactive voice response trees without code

Combined with Salesforce's Omni-Channel routing, calls are distributed alongside chats and cases based on agent availability and capacity.

7. Warm Transfers With Full Context

When an agent needs to transfer a call:

  • Agent availability display — See which team members are available and their current capacity
  • Warm transfer — Brief the receiving agent with customer context before completing the transfer
  • Context preservation — All notes, transcription, and sentiment data carry forward to the new agent

No more cold transfers where customers have to start from scratch.

Aircall AI Features Within Service Cloud Voice

Aircall's AI capabilities extend well beyond basic transcription. Here's what's available within the Salesforce SCV environment:

AI Assist and AI Assist Pro

Aircall's AI Assist provides real-time in-call guidance:

  • Pre-call summaries — Brief agents on the customer's history and likely issue before they answer
  • Real-time coaching prompts — Suggest responses, flag compliance-sensitive topics, and recommend upsell opportunities
  • Post-call automation — Auto-generate summaries, update CRM fields, and create follow-up tasks

AI Assist Pro adds advanced capabilities:

  • Call whispering — Managers coach agents in real-time without the customer hearing
  • Automated CRM updates — AI writes structured data back to Salesforce records
  • Workflow triggers — Automatically launch Salesforce flows based on call outcomes

AI Voice Agent

Aircall's AI Voice Agent handles routine calls autonomously:

  • 24/7 availability — Answers calls outside business hours using natural language processing
  • FAQ resolution — Handles common questions without human intervention
  • Lead qualification — Captures caller information and qualifies intent before routing to an agent
  • Smart escalation — Seamlessly transfers to a human agent when the conversation requires it

Talk-to-Listen Ratios and Coaching Analytics

For sales and service managers, Aircall surfaces conversation analytics:

  • Talk-to-listen ratios — Measure how much agents talk versus listen (top performers typically listen more)
  • Call scoring — Automated quality ratings based on sentiment, topic coverage, and outcomes
  • Trend analysis — Track team performance across days, weeks, and months
  • Coaching insights — Identify specific agents who need training on specific topics

Comparison: Aircall vs. Amazon Connect vs. Five9 vs. Genesys

Choosing a Service Cloud Voice telephony partner is a critical decision. Here's how Aircall stacks up against the major alternatives:

Criteria Aircall Amazon Connect Five9 Genesys Cloud CX
Best For SMB to mid-market teams wanting fast deployment and AI-rich features Large enterprises needing AWS-scale infrastructure Enterprise contact centers with complex routing Global enterprises with workforce management needs
SCV Integration Native embedded (2025+) Native (Salesforce default partner) Native + CTI options Native Cloud CX integration
Setup Time Days to weeks Weeks to months Weeks to months Months (complex enterprise deployments)
AI Features Transcription, sentiment, summaries, key topics, AI Voice Agent, coaching analytics Contact Lens (transcription, sentiment) Advanced analytics, AI routing, predictive dialing Predictive engagement AI, workforce management
Pricing Model Per-user/month ($30/user SCV add-on + $9/user AI add-on) Usage-based (~$0.018/min) ~$140+/user/month Custom enterprise quotes
CRM Integrations 200+ native integrations (Salesforce, HubSpot, and more) AWS-ecosystem focused Salesforce-focused Multi-CRM support
Ease of Use Intuitive, minimal training needed Technical — requires AWS expertise Moderate complexity High complexity, powerful capabilities
Unique Strength Speed to value + AI-first approach + dual CRM support Infinite scalability on AWS Predictive dialing and workforce optimization Enterprise-grade workforce management

When to Choose Aircall

Aircall is the strongest fit when your organization:

  • Wants to be live in days, not months
  • Needs AI features (transcription, sentiment, summaries) included out of the box
  • Uses both Salesforce and HubSpot (Aircall integrates natively with both)
  • Values simplicity and transparent pricing over enterprise-scale complexity
  • Has a team of 10–500 agents (sweet spot for Aircall's platform)

When to Consider Alternatives

  • Amazon Connect — If you're already deep in the AWS ecosystem and need pay-per-minute pricing at massive scale
  • Five9 — If you need advanced outbound dialing capabilities and workforce optimization for 500+ agents
  • Genesys — If you require global workforce management, complex multi-site routing, and enterprise-grade SLA guarantees

Setup and Implementation Guide

Prerequisites

Before implementing Aircall for Salesforce Service Cloud Voice, ensure you have:

  1. Aircall Professional Plan (or higher)
  2. Salesforce Service Cloud Voice licenses for each agent
  3. Salesforce admin access to configure the SCV integration
  4. Aircall admin access to manage phone numbers, routing, and AI settings

Step-by-Step Configuration

Step 1: Connect Aircall to Salesforce SCV

  1. Log in to your Aircall admin dashboard
  2. Navigate to Integrations > Salesforce Service Cloud Voice
  3. Authorize the connection with your Salesforce org
  4. Map your Aircall phone numbers to Salesforce SCV channels

Step 2: Configure Omni-Channel Routing

  1. In Salesforce Setup, navigate to Service Cloud Voice > Phone Channels
  2. Assign your Aircall numbers to the appropriate channels
  3. Configure Omni-Channel routing rules — set agent capacity, skill-based routing, and priority queues
  4. Define presence statuses so the system knows when agents are available for calls

Step 3: Set Up Smartflows (Call Routing)

  1. In Aircall, build your Smartflows routing logic: define business hours and holiday schedules, create IVR menus for caller self-service, set team-based routing rules, and configure overflow and failover scenarios
  2. Test routing with internal calls before going live

Step 4: Enable AI Features

  1. In Aircall settings, enable: real-time transcription, sentiment analysis, call summaries and key topics, and AI Assist (if included in your plan)
  2. Configure which AI insights auto-log to Salesforce VoiceCall records
  3. Set up supervisor dashboards for real-time monitoring

Step 5: Train Your Team

  1. Walk agents through the in-console call controls (answer, hold, mute, transfer)
  2. Show them where customer context and AI insights appear during calls
  3. Demonstrate warm transfer workflows
  4. Review post-call summary review and wrap-up process

Implementation Best Practices

  • Start with a pilot team — Roll out to 5–10 agents first, collect feedback, then expand
  • Customize your Smartflows — Generic routing wastes time; map your actual team structure and escalation paths
  • Enable AI features incrementally — Start with transcription and summaries, then add sentiment and coaching analytics
  • Set up reporting early — Configure Salesforce dashboards to track call volume, handle time, resolution rates, and CSAT from day one
  • Plan your data model — Decide which VoiceCall fields map to your reporting needs before launch
